Winfield SD 34 outlines recruitment push for hard-to-fill positions ahead of 2026–27 school year
Summary
District officials reported openings for a social worker, a first-grade teacher and a middle-school science teacher and described plans to post positions in late February–March, attend regional job fairs and begin applicant screening in March.

Administrators told the board the district expects openings in several hard-to-fill roles for 2026–27, including a social worker, a first-grade teacher and a middle-school science teacher.
The district is participating in multiple regional job fairs and university partnerships to broaden the applicant pool. Positions are typically posted in late February through March to align with recruitment timelines; applicant screening was described as expected to begin in March with staff and administrators participating in interviews and selection processes.
Board members heard that the administration is confident in current recruitment strategies while monitoring applicant volume and candidate quality. No specific candidate names or hiring decisions were made at the Jan. 29 meeting.
